Marine-grade chloride exposure within 200 meters of Galveston Bay, flat-lot topography requiring engineered drainage gradient, and industrial particulate fallout on Westside properties. The flat-lot drainage issue is the failure mechanism that catches installers who do not run a transit-level survey before base preparation.
Marine-grade hardware (316 stainless), epoxy adhesive throughout, base crowning to create drainage gradient on flat lots, subsurface perforated drain systems where needed, and cork-blend infill for Westside industrial-corridor properties.
An installation engineered for La Porte's specific exposure conditions gives seam adhesive that holds under repeated chloride cycling, drainage that functions after a tropical event, and infill chemistry that does not degrade under the industrial air-shed conditions of the Westside.
Chloride exposure classification, transit-level drainage survey, marine-grade hardware selection if applicable, #57 limestone base with crown grading, epoxy seam adhesive application during low-humidity morning window, cork-blend or standard infill distribution based on location, written drainage flow test at closeout.
